Immerse yourself in a new reality at SXSW

vr_1024_andrewwchoi%28SpiderVR%29+copy
Andrew Choi

Technologies such as virtual reality, augmented reality and mixed reality can feel futuristic and out of reach. South by Southwest is bringing these technologies to Austin’s own backyard.

These technologies are powerful tools for multiple industries. With lots to explore, it can be difficult knowing where to start. The Daily Texan has compiled this list of VR, AR and MR opportunities at SXSW.

Exhibits


SXSW is holding a virtual cinema showcasing 26 unique stories from VR exhibitors at the JW Marriott in Griffin Hall from March 11 through March 13. With engaging documentaries, comedic narratives and immersive experiences, there is something for everyone. 

Follow the life of 17-year-old Rani, who is determined to fight cultural norms, from Varanasi, India with “Girl Icon” at booth 71. A dance-oriented experience is available at Booth Nine with “Runnin,” a retro-future interactive dance party. Take part in a fight for survival on an island planet with “Eleven Eleven” at booth 16.

Speaker Sessions

While the virtual cinema shows what these technologies can do, SXSW is also designating sessions for discussion. Key speakers will explore the ins and outs of how VR, AR and MR can impact specific industries.

With the emergence of these immersive technologies, many may worry about isolation and a disconnect from the world. The panel session, “Better with Friends: The Social Life of VR,” will discuss ways to connect the real and virtual worlds to improve communication. (March 13 from 12:30 p.m.–1:30 p.m. at JW Marriott, Salon 1-2) 

“An Honest Hologram? The Ethics of MR Design” is a dual speaker session that will explore the issue of ethics when utilizing these technologies and offer tools to implement boundaries. (March 11 from 11 a.m.–12 p.m. at JW Marriott, Salon 1-2)

Other sessions explore topics such as VR, AR and MR in sports, space programs and marketing, so look at the full list to find a niche. 

Workshop Sessions

For a more hands-on experience, SXSW is offering three workshops. 

Get to work and learn the fundamentals of designing AR at “Build Your Own AR Prototype,” where participants create and test their own engaging experience. (March 11 from 3:30 p.m.–5:30 p.m. at Westin Austin Downtown, Continental 1)

Interested in app development? “Chalk Talk: Developing for VR, AR and MR,” invites participants to explore the creation of apps using VR and AR technologies. (March 11 from 12:30 p.m.–2 p.m. at Westin Austin Downtown, The Gallery Room, or March 12 from 3:30 p.m.–5 p.m. at Westin Austin Downtown, Continental 1)

Meet Up Sessions

Networking is heavily emphasized for college students. Luckily, it’s also a large part of SXSW. Virtual technology enthusiasts can find their people at these sessions.

“The Women in XR Meet Up” is for the ladies. Meet with other women in the virtual technology industry, share experiences and discuss ideas about the future. (March 13 from 11 a.m.–12 p.m. at Fairmont, Wisteria Room)

The “VR/AR Healthcare Meet Up” will connect you to professionals in the healthcare industry to discuss how the future of technology can impact the clinical setting. (March 13 from 11 a.m. –12 p.m. at Fairmont, Primrose)
